· 0...1 bar to 0...16 bar
· For corrosive pressure media
· Excellent low temperature drift
· All welded stainless steel
· For hostile environments
Media wetted parts: any liquid or vapor that is
compatible with stainless steel 316 (1.4401)
absolute or gage
diaphragm construction
